summaryrefslogtreecommitdiffstats
path: root/Lib/importlib/_abc.py
diff options
context:
space:
mode:
authorBarry Warsaw <barry@python.org>2022-08-05 00:24:26 (GMT)
committerGitHub <noreply@github.com>2022-08-05 00:24:26 (GMT)
commite1182bc3776ea7cfdd3f82d5ba4fdfee40ae57ee (patch)
treea83cbfa65f28dd2de5cefdabecd7daa925152f28 /Lib/importlib/_abc.py
parent44f1f63ad5cf00b6f50cef0cc1a62c42632138be (diff)
downloadcpython-e1182bc3776ea7cfdd3f82d5ba4fdfee40ae57ee.zip
cpython-e1182bc3776ea7cfdd3f82d5ba4fdfee40ae57ee.tar.gz
cpython-e1182bc3776ea7cfdd3f82d5ba4fdfee40ae57ee.tar.bz2
gh-94619: Remove long deprecated methods module_repr() and load_module() (#94624)
* gh-94619: Remove long deprecated methods module_repr() and load_module() Closes #94619 * Update Misc/NEWS.d/next/Library/2022-07-06-14-57-33.gh-issue-94619.PRqKVX.rst Fix typo Co-authored-by: Brett Cannon <brett@python.org> Co-authored-by: Brett Cannon <brett@python.org>
Diffstat (limited to 'Lib/importlib/_abc.py')
-rw-r--r--Lib/importlib/_abc.py14
1 files changed, 0 insertions, 14 deletions
diff --git a/Lib/importlib/_abc.py b/Lib/importlib/_abc.py
index f80348f..0832056 100644
--- a/Lib/importlib/_abc.py
+++ b/Lib/importlib/_abc.py
@@ -38,17 +38,3 @@ class Loader(metaclass=abc.ABCMeta):
raise ImportError
# Warning implemented in _load_module_shim().
return _bootstrap._load_module_shim(self, fullname)
-
- def module_repr(self, module):
- """Return a module's repr.
-
- Used by the module type when the method does not raise
- NotImplementedError.
-
- This method is deprecated.
-
- """
- warnings.warn("importlib.abc.Loader.module_repr() is deprecated and "
- "slated for removal in Python 3.12", DeprecationWarning)
- # The exception will cause ModuleType.__repr__ to ignore this method.
- raise NotImplementedError